Python for Data Analysis, Wes McKinney

Python for Data Analysis, Wes McKinney

Python for Data Analysis: A Comprehensive Guide to Manipulating, Cleaning, and Exploring Data in Python

Introduction

In today's data-driven world, the ability to analyze and interpret data is a crucial skill for professionals across various industries. Python, a versatile and powerful programming language, has emerged as a preferred tool for data analysis due to its extensive libraries, ease of use, and vast community support.

Why Python for Data Analysis?

Python offers a plethora of advantages for data analysis, making it the language of choice for many data scientists and analysts. Here are a few reasons why Python stands out:

Simplicity and Readability:

Python's syntax is straightforward and easy to learn, allowing even beginners to quickly grasp the basics and start working with data. Its readability enables analysts to focus on the analysis itself rather than getting bogged down by complex syntax.

Extensive Libraries:

Python boasts a rich ecosystem of libraries specifically designed for data analysis and manipulation. Libraries like NumPy, pandas, and SciPy provide powerful tools for numerical computations, data wrangling, and statistical analysis.

Data Visualization:

Python offers excellent data visualization capabilities through libraries such as Matplotlib and Seaborn. These libraries enable the creation of interactive and informative charts, graphs, and plots to effectively communicate data insights.

Community Support:

Python has a vast and active community of data scientists, analysts, and developers who continuously contribute to the language's development and share their knowledge and expertise. This vibrant community ensures that Python remains at the forefront of data analysis advancements.

What You'll Learn from "Python for Data Analysis"

Wes McKinney's "Python for Data Analysis" is a comprehensive guide that takes you on a journey through the world of data analysis using Python. This book is perfect for beginners and intermediate-level users who want to master the art of data manipulation, cleaning, and exploration.

Data Manipulation:

Learn how to efficiently manipulate and transform data using Python's powerful tools. Discover techniques for reshaping data, merging datasets, and handling missing values.

Data Cleaning:

Master the art of data cleaning, a crucial step in data analysis. Explore methods for identifying and removing duplicate data, dealing with outliers, and handling inconsistent data formats.

Data Exploration:

Gain insights from your data through effective exploration techniques. Learn how to summarize data, perform exploratory data analysis (EDA), and identify patterns and trends.

Real-World Case Studies:

Reinforce your learning by working through real-world case studies. These practical examples demonstrate how to apply the concepts and techniques covered in the book to solve real-world data analysis problems.

Why You Should Buy "Python for Data Analysis"

"Python for Data Analysis" is an essential resource for anyone looking to enhance their data analysis skills using Python. Here's why you should consider purchasing this book:

Comprehensive Coverage:

This book covers a wide range of topics, from data manipulation and cleaning to data exploration and visualization. It provides a comprehensive understanding of the entire data analysis process.

Clear and Concise Explanations:

Wes McKinney presents complex concepts in a clear and concise manner, making them easy to understand even for beginners. The book's logical structure and step-by-step approach ensure a smooth learning experience.

Practical Examples and Exercises:

Each chapter is accompanied by practical examples and exercises that reinforce the concepts discussed. These hands-on activities allow you to apply your knowledge and gain practical experience.

Up-to-Date Content:

The book is regularly updated to keep pace with the latest advancements in Python and data analysis. This ensures that you have access to the most current information and techniques.

Conclusion

"Python for Data Analysis" by Wes McKinney is an invaluable resource for anyone interested in mastering data analysis using Python. Its comprehensive coverage, clear explanations, practical examples, and up-to-date content make it a must-have for data scientists, analysts, and anyone looking to unlock the power of data. Invest in this book and embark on a journey to becoming a proficient data analyst with Python.